SUMMARY OF WORK

The Afghanistan Air Force (AAF) Aviation Enhancement at Mazar-e-Sharif consists of the design and construction of a new Life Support Area (LSA) Expansion, a new mixed-use aircraft airfield identified as “Operations Airfield”, and other additional support facilities and utilities. The LSA Expansion and new Operations Airfield are briefly summarized, as follows:

 

Life Support Area Expansion (LSA): The LSA Expansion consists of new officer, NCO, and enlisted barracks to support the AAF, including a new Dinning Facility (DFAC), storage facility, and administration facilities. In addition, the new LSA include a new perimeter wall, guard towers, road, sidewalks, a well and water distribution system, wastewater collection system, an electrical distribution system and power connection, a new Wastewater Treatment Plant (WWTP), a new sewer force main to convey wastewater from the existing LSA to the new WWTP, furniture for facilities, and all incidental work and requirements for a complete and usable LSA.

 

Operations Airfield: The new Operations Airfield consists of a new “Papa” Taxiway to replace the existing degraded Papa Taxiway, a new Armed Aircraft Apron, new Munitions Storage facility, a new Military (MIL.) Ramp Taxiway to replace degraded reaches of the existing MIL. Ramp Taxiway, new UH-60 aircraft hangars, a new Fixed-Wing Apron which utilizes the refurbishing existing paved aprons, utilities and service connections, and all incidental work and requirements for a complete and useable airfield.
